    Investigo - DX9 Performance and Debugging Toolkit

    Investigo is a toolkit for DirectX9 performance analysis and debugging. For any DirectX9 application: view live performance graphs via the embedded HTTP server and capture performance metrics for offline analysis. Investigo is released under an MIT style licence.     Logbus-ng consists in a set of tools to aid developers perform Log Analysis in all the stages: log generation, collection, distribution, storage and analysis. It is designed specifically for Field Failure Data Analysis in critical distributed systems

    The Artemus Project aims to create tools for the analysis of C# and PowerPC assembly code on the Xbox 360 using XNA Game Studio. These tools will allow XNA Game Studio developers to identify sections of code that may negatively impact performance.

    JMonitoring and NMonitoring are monitoring frameworks for Java and .Net applications, based on AOP (AspectJ and AspectDNG). Data are stored in database, memory or XML and can be consulted with a web console. http://forge.octo.com/confluence/display/JMO
